Has anyone who has gotten ahold of a 2013 Haswell iMac been able to determine if it is using the newer third generation (Redwood Ridge) Thunderbolt chip? This is the chip Intel's docs claim should be shipping with Haswell processors and allows DisplayPort 1.2 pass through when connected directly to the machine.
